How can I watch every cost and make sure there is minimal waste?

Customized Data Base of Services

The first step is to find a tracking data base and input all relevant payables.  The second step in the process is to inventory all services and to obtain copies of the current agreements with the vendor(s). 

Following up on expiration dates, agreed to pricing and just vendor contract terms is a complex process made simple with the right type of tracking data base.  The information must be accurately keyed into a tracking data base with the relevant fields filled in so that following up will become automatic.

Watching Prices and Accuracy of Charges

Once the data base of information is established and not less than every six months, items that add up to over $500/month must be checked with the market place pricing.  Three quotes are essential to determine the best possible prices.  Also, the Internet is a big help for research.

All purchases that exceed $3,000/month must be compared to agreed to pricing schedules on a item to item basis.  If the invoicing systems do not enable price checking to take place in an efficient manner, require the vendor to either change the format or deliver the invoice information in an electric format.  If that is not possible change vendors.  Confusion on cost per item will yield overcharges in many cases.

Validate All Promises

When the first set of invoices arrives, after negotiations are completed and the new program is in place, check each item against an agreed to price list and/or agreed to discount formula and verify that all terms and conditions have been implemented.

It is very common, on new agreements, that the agreed to terms and conditions are not properly implemented.

This causes overcharges and enables the vendor/service provider the excuse that the initial implementation was not done correctly.  If this is not fixed the vendor/service provider can get away with over charges for days, months and possibly never get caught.  This becomes very costly.

It is extremely rare that the vendor/service providers have a system in place to correct overcharges.  The bigger the company the less likely that the vendor/service provider will correct over charges automatically.
